I Had To Make A Garden Fence Because Of The Chipmunks

We had to put a small fence around the garden.  A chipmunk got in and ate half the broccoli and lettuce plants.  We used the mesh that protects the trees to make the fence.  It is only about 1 1/2 feet tall, but this fence has made a huge difference!  


We still have 3 broccoli plants left.  One is starting grow broccoli!

Keep Bugs Away From Seedlings

Use a coffee sleeve around a seedling to keep the bugs away from delicate stems.

More Plants In The Garden!


We checked the weather for the next 10 days and it looks like it will be beautiful.  I was so excited to plant more plants in my garden. We went to Lowes and picked out three tomato plants, two pepper plants and some marigolds to keep the bad bugs away.  We will still need to cover the garden bed if there is a frost, but I am so excited to be starting my full garden. 


We planted Cubanelle and Red Bell Sweet Peppers.  For tomatoes, we planted Husky Cherry Red, Beefsteak and some sort of purple tomato.
